OCaml: Pad List with Zeros using Folding

I've been stuck on this for hours now - wondering if anyone could help me out.

I have two Lists of different lengths, and I want to pad the shorter list with 0's so that the two lists have the same length.

I want to do this using the Folding functions, and NOT using recursion.

Any hints are very appreciated!

It's not completely clear what you mean by "the folding functions." You can't use List.fold_left2 or List.fold_right2 to fold over both lists at once, as these assume that the input lists are already the same length. This leaves List.fold_left and List.fold_right (it seems to me).

If you're allowed to make an initial pass to get the lengths of the two lists, you can fold over the shorter list to make a copy with padding added at the end. (Right fold is easiest, though it doesn't work so well for very long lists.)

One problem with this approach is that you'd have to make the padding separately, and this might require recursion (due mostly to limits of OCaml library IMHO). Another approach would be to fold over the longer list while traversing and copying the shorter one. The longer list would function as a measure telling you how much padding to add once the shorter list is exhausted. This would be quite a bit more complex.

If either approach seems worth looking at, you might start by writing a function that uses List.fold_right just to copy a list. This is pretty close to what you want to do (it seems to me).

Finding the length of a list itself is recursive. In any case, here's my crack at the problem. I used tabulate function from SML's List structure. Also, I'm assuming you're familiar with anonymous functions.

fun put_zeroes lst1 lst2 =
    let 
        val zero_nums = List.length(lst2)-List.length(lst1)
        val pad_zeroes = List.tabulate(zero_nums,fn x => 0)
        val new_lst1 = lst1@pad_zeroes                   
    in
        new_lst1
    end
